What is the KHSAA Eligibility Rules and Parental Permission Form?
The KHSAA Eligibility Rules and Parental Permission Form is a crucial document used within the Kentucky High School Athletic Association (KHSAA) to ensure that student athletes meet eligibility requirements for participation in high school sports. This form is essential for verifying that students have proper insurance coverage and are eligible to compete. The form requires signatures from three key parties: parents or guardians, students, and health care providers, making it a vital step in the registration process for student athletes.

What are the eligibility requirements for student athletes?
Student athletes must meet specific eligibility rules set by the KHSAA, including age limits, residency requirements, and compliance with academic standards. Ensure you review the latest eligibility guidelines from KHSAA to confirm if a student qualifies.

What supporting documents do I need?
Typically, you'll need to provide insurance information, medical clearance from a health care provider, and verification of parental consent. Confirm with your school if additional documents are required for submission.
